#! armclang -E --target=arm-arm-none-eabi -x c -mcpu=cortex-m0
; The first line specifies a preprocessor command that the linker invokes
; to pass a scatter file through a C preprocessor.

;*******************************************************************************
;* \file cyb06xx5_cm0plus.sct
;* \version 2.90.1
;*
;* Linker file for the ARMCC.
;*
;* The main purpose of the linker script is to describe how the sections in the
;* input files should be mapped into the output file, and to control the memory
;* layout of the output file.
;*
;* \note The entry point location is fixed and starts at 0x10000000. The valid
;* application image should be placed there.
;*
;* \note The linker files included with the PDL template projects must be
;* generic and handle all common use cases. Your project may not use every
;* section defined in the linker files. In that case you may see the warnings
;* during the build process: L6314W (no section matches pattern) and/or L6329W
;* (pattern only matches removed unused sections). In your project, you can
;* suppress the warning by passing the "--diag_suppress=L6314W,L6329W" option to
;* the linker, simply comment out or remove the relevant code in the linker
;* file.
